Job Responsibility

  • Outline strategies and road maps that lead efforts to align with DoD standards, mitigate risks, and facilitate seamless CPSR audits by the DCMA
  • CPSR Audit Preparedness: Ensure compliance within the supply chain organization as related to CPSR audits and global compliance
  • CPSR Audit Execution: Oversee all internal and external audit activity and build strong relationships with the DCMA CPSR auditors and the ACO, coordinating on-site/virtual audits, document submissions, and response timelines
  • Global Supply Chain Compliance: Set strategy and vision for overall global supply chain compliance for US DoD and international operations, ensuring adherence to country-specific regulations (e.g., EU GDPR, UK Bribery Act, Australian Defense Export Controls) across 20+ partner countries
  • Ongoing Compliance Support: Be aware of all supply chain compliance regulation changes and incorporate them into operating standards
